Processing of financial transactions using debit networks
Abstract
Methods and systems are disclosed for executing financial transactions between customers and merchants. An identifier of a financial account is received from the customer at a merchant system. A one-time password is also received from the customer at the merchant system, with the customer having been provided with the one-time password by a mobile electronic device or contactless presentation instrument. A cryptogram is generated to include the identifier of the financial account encrypted using the one-time password. An authorization request is formulated at the merchant system. The authorization request includes the cryptogram and transaction information describing at least a portion of the financial transaction. The authorization request is transmitted from the merchant system to an authorization processor for authorization of the financial transaction.
Claims
exact text as granted — not AI-modified1 . A method of executing a financial transaction between a customer and a merchant, the method comprising:
receiving an encrypted authorization request from a merchant system at an authorization processor, wherein the authorization request was encrypted by application of a one-time password provided to the merchant by a presentation instrument; decrypting the authorization request; identifying a financial account from the decrypted authorization request; determining transaction information describing at least a portion of the financial transaction from the decrypted authorization request; determining authenticity of the transaction information by validating the one-time password; and determining whether the identified financial account is capable of supporting the financial transaction based on the transaction information.
2 . The method recited in claim 1 further comprising delivering a loyalty customer identification number from the presentation instrument to the merchant.
3 . The method recited in claim 1 wherein the identifier comprises an account number of the financial account.
4 . The method recited in claim 1 wherein the one-time password comprises a two-factor one-time password.
5 . The method recited in claim 1 wherein the merchant system comprises an Internet web server.
6 . The method recited in claim 1 wherein the merchant system comprises a merchant point-of-sale device.
7 . The method recited in claim 1 further comprising verifying authenticity of the one-time password by validating the personal identification number associated with the identified financial account.
8 . The method recited in claim 1 wherein the debit presentation instrument comprises a cellular telephone.
9 . The method recited in claim 1 wherein the transaction information comprises data selected from the group consisting of a total cost for the financial transaction, a location, a point-of-sale-device identifier, a point-of-sale-device sequence number, a date, and a time.
10 . The method recited in claim 1 wherein the financial account comprises an account selected from the group consisting of a debit account, a credit account, and a stored-value account.
